A standard 4K resolution features a grid of 3840 x 2160 pixels. However, resolution alone does not guarantee a premium image. "Extra quality" is achieved by maximizing several core display metrics:

Managing top-tier media files requires specific storage architecture due to massive file sizes. A single hour of extra-quality 4K video can easily exceed dozens of gigabytes.
